What Is Zeekr? Understanding the Brand Behind the 9X
Before evaluating the vehicle itself, understanding Zeekr’s corporate pedigree matters significantly for long-term ownership considerations.
Zeekr operates as the premium electric vehicle arm of Geely Holding Group, one of the world’s largest automotive conglomerates. This isn’t a fly-by-night startup chasing EV subsidies. Geely’s portfolio includes:
| Brand | Market Position | Relevance to Zeekr 9X |
|---|---|---|
| Volvo | Premium Safety | Shared safety engineering protocols |
| Polestar | Performance EV | Common SEA platform architecture |
| Lotus | Ultra-Performance | Chassis tuning expertise |
| Mercedes-Benz (Stake) | Luxury Benchmark | Design and quality influence |
| Lynk & Co | Global Premium | Manufacturing scale |
This corporate backing provides Zeekr with something most EV startups lack: established supply chains, proven manufacturing quality, and the financial stability to support long-term warranty obligations.
Design and Exterior: Science Fiction Meets Luxury Yacht
The Zeekr 9X’s visual presence immediately distinguishes it from conventional SUVs. At 5,290mm in length with a 3,220mm wheelbase, it exceeds both the Tesla Model X and BMW iX in overall dimensions.

Key Design Elements
Front Fascia: The integrated grille spans over 120cm in width, paired with a clamshell hood exceeding 2 square meters. This design language draws comparisons to Rolls-Royce’s Cullinan, though executed with distinctly modern proportions.
Lighting Technology: Dual million-pixel intelligent projection headlights provide adaptive beam patterns. The full-width rear light bar incorporates animated sequences that activate during vehicle startup.
Aerodynamic Efficiency: Despite its substantial size, the 9X achieves a drag coefficient of 0.25—remarkable for a seven-seat SUV and competitive with luxury sedans.
Wheel Options: Available up to 22 inches, with flush-mounted door handles that deploy electronically.

Performance Specifications: Beyond the Marketing Claims
The Zeekr 9X runs on Geely’s SEA (Sustainable Experience Architecture) platform, the same foundation underpinning Polestar and Lotus EVs. This shared architecture provides genuine sports car engineering DNA rather than adapted commuter car underpinnings.
Powertrain Options
| Variant | Power Output | 0-100 km/h | Drivetrain |
|---|---|---|---|
| Single Motor RWD | ~300 hp | ~6.5 seconds | Rear-wheel drive |
| Dual Motor AWD | ~500 hp | <4.0 seconds | All-wheel drive |
| Tri-Motor (Hyper) | ~750 hp | 3.1 seconds | All-wheel drive |
Battery and Charging
| Specification | Value | Real-World Context |
|---|---|---|
| Battery Capacity | Up to 100 kWh | Competitive with segment leaders |
| CLTC Range | Up to 1,165 km | ~500-600 km realistic mixed driving |
| Pure Electric Range | 288-380 km (PHEV) | Sufficient for daily commuting |
| Charging Architecture | 900V | Enables ultra-fast charging |
| Max Charging Power | 480 kW | 10-80% in approximately 15 minutes |
| 15-Minute Charge | ~300 km range | Class-leading replenishment speed |
Critical Performance Analysis
The headline acceleration figures warrant careful examination. While the 3.1-second 0-100 km/h claim for the tri-motor Hyper variant is technically achievable, this represents optimal conditions with maximum battery charge. Real-world repeated launches will show degradation as thermal management systems engage.
The 900V charging architecture genuinely differentiates the 9X from competitors still utilizing 400V systems. However, accessing 480kW charging requires specific ultra-high-power charging stations that remain limited outside China and select European corridors.
Autonomous Driving: L3 Capability That Actually Works
This is where the Zeekr 9X makes its most significant technological statement. While Tesla continues marketing “Full Self-Driving” that legally requires constant driver supervision, Zeekr has implemented genuine Level 3 autonomous capability.

Qianli Haohan H9 Autonomous System
| Component | Specification | Competitive Advantage |
|---|---|---|
| Computing Platform | Dual NVIDIA Thor chips | 1,400 TOPS total compute |
| LiDAR Sensors | 5 primary units | 360-degree coverage |
| Blind Spot Radar | 4 units | Eliminated peripheral盲区 |
| Total Sensors | 43 units | Comprehensive environmental awareness |
| Autonomous Level | L3 certified | Hands-off highway driving legal |
| Backup Systems | Dual braking, redundant steering | Fail-safe operation |
Tesla vs. Zeekr: Philosophy Comparison
| Aspect | Tesla Vision | Zeekr H9 |
|---|---|---|
| Primary Sensors | Cameras only | LiDAR + Cameras + Radar |
| Computing Power | ~720 TOPS (FSD 4.0) | 1,400 TOPS |
| Autonomous Level | L2+ (driver supervision required) | L3 (hands-off permitted) |
| Elon Musk’s View | LiDAR is a “crutch” | LiDAR provides redundancy |
| Highway Autonomy | Requires hands on wheel | Legal hands-off operation |
Practical Implications
Level 3 certification means the 9X can legally operate without driver input on designated highways under specific conditions. The driver may look away from the road, though they must remain prepared to resume control when the system requests. This represents a genuine functional difference from Tesla’s Level 2+ system, which legally requires continuous driver attention.
Interior and Luxury Appointments: Tech-Forward or Timeless?
Stepping into the Zeekr 9X reveals an interior that balances technological sophistication with traditional luxury cues.


Cabin Configuration
| Layout | Seating | Best For |
|---|---|---|
| 2-3-2 | Seven seats | Maximum passenger capacity |
| 2-2-2 | Six seats (captain’s chairs) | Premium comfort |
| Ultra Luxury | Four executive seats | Chauffeur-driven scenarios |
Technology Features
| Feature | Specification | User Experience |
|---|---|---|
| Infotainment Display | 15.6-inch OLED | Crisp resolution, responsive touch |
| Driver Display | Fully digital cluster | Customizable information presentation |
| Head-Up Display | AR projection | Navigation and warnings in sightline |
| Steering Wheel | Two-spoke with haptic controls | Modern aesthetic, tactile feedback |
| Sound System | Yamaha 21-speaker 3D audio | Immersive audio experience |
| Ambient Lighting | 256 colors | Personalization without distraction |
Seat Comfort and Materials
All seating positions include ventilation, heating, and massage functions. The second-row captain’s chairs recline to near-flat positions, transforming the cabin into a mobile lounge. Third-row passengers receive legitimate accommodations rather than token seating, with dedicated cup holders and USB-C ports.
Material selections include premium Nappa leather, sustainable wood alternatives, and plant-based composite trim pieces. The overall impression suggests Mercedes-EQS levels of refinement with a more contemporary aesthetic.

Pricing and Value Proposition: The Numbers That Matter
This is where the Zeekr 9X creates genuine market disruption.
Competitive Pricing Analysis (USD Equivalent)
| Vehicle | Starting Price | Price Difference vs. 9X |
|---|---|---|
| Zeekr 9X | $65,000-$85,000 | Baseline |
| Tesla Model X | $90,000+ | +38% higher |
| BMW iX xDrive50 | $90,000+ | +38% higher |
| Mercedes EQS SUV | $105,000+ | +62% higher |
| Audi Q8 e-tron | $75,000+ | +15% higher |
| AITO M9 | $70,000+ | +8% higher |
Chinese Market Pricing (RMB)
| Variant | Price (RMB) | Price (USD Approx.) |
|---|---|---|
| 2.0T 300km Max | 465,900 | $65,000 |
| 2.0T 288km Ultra | 485,900 | $68,000 |
| 2.0T 380km Ultra | 500,900 | $70,000 |
| 2.0T 355km Hyper | 559,900 | $78,000 |
| 2.0T 355km Obsidian | 599,900 | $85,000 |
Value Assessment
The pricing strategy positions the 9X aggressively against established luxury brands. However, prospective buyers should consider several factors beyond initial purchase price:
Resale Value Uncertainty: Chinese luxury EVs lack established resale value histories in Western markets. Early adopters may experience steeper depreciation than comparable German vehicles.
Service Network Limitations: Outside China and select European markets, authorized service centers remain limited. This could impact convenience and potentially repair costs.
Warranty Considerations: Understanding warranty coverage specifics and claim processes in your region is essential before purchase.

Market Availability: Where Can You Actually Buy One?
Geographic availability significantly impacts the 9X’s competitive positioning.
Current Market Status
| Region | Availability | Barriers |
|---|---|---|
| China | Available | Primary market, full support |
| Europe | Expanding | Germany, Netherlands, Norway initial markets |
| United States | Not Available | Import tariffs, regulatory hurdles |
| Southeast Asia | Planned | Malaysia, Thailand under consideration |
| Middle East | Limited | Select markets through partners |
United States Market Reality
American consumers cannot currently purchase the Zeekr 9X through official channels. Several factors contribute to this limitation:
- Import Tariffs: Current US tariffs on Chinese-manufactured vehicles effectively eliminate the 9X’s price advantage
- Regulatory Compliance: US safety and emissions standards require specific certifications
- Dealer Network: No established US distribution infrastructure exists
Zeekr could potentially circumvent tariff barriers by establishing manufacturing facilities in Mexico or Europe for North American distribution. However, no such plans have been officially announced.
European Expansion Strategy
Zeekr has committed to aggressive European expansion, beginning with Germany, the Netherlands, and Norway. These markets provide:
- Established EV infrastructure
- Favorable regulatory environments for Chinese EVs
- Consumers open to premium EV alternatives

Maintenance and Service
The super-electric hybrid powertrain combines traditional internal combustion elements with electric propulsion. This complexity offers flexibility but introduces additional maintenance considerations compared to pure EVs.
Advantages:
- Reduced range anxiety for long-distance travel
- Flexibility when charging infrastructure is limited
- Potential fuel cost savings for daily commuting
Considerations:
- More complex powertrain than pure EV
- Requires both fuel and electrical system maintenance
- Long-term reliability data still accumulating

Frequently Asked Questions
Q: Is the Zeekr 9X fully electric or hybrid? A: The 9X utilizes super-electric hybrid (plug-in hybrid) technology, combining a 2.0T engine with electric motors. This provides flexibility for both electric-only commuting and extended range travel.
Q: Can the Zeekr 9X use Tesla Superchargers? A: With appropriate adapters, the 9X can access Tesla Supercharger networks in regions where this compatibility is enabled. Native CCS2 charging is standard in European markets.
Q: What warranty coverage does Zeekr provide? A: Warranty terms vary by market. Typical coverage includes 8 years/160,000 km for battery components and 4 years/100,000 km for vehicle systems. Confirm specific terms with local dealers.
Q: When will the Zeekr 9X be available in the United States? A: No official US launch date has been announced. Import tariffs and regulatory requirements present significant barriers. Manufacturing partnerships or local production would be required for viable US market entry.
Q: How does the L3 autonomous system work in practice? A: The H9 system permits hands-off driving on designated highways under specific conditions. The driver must remain attentive and ready to resume control when the system requests intervention.
